Terminology3.1 DefinitionsTerms used in this test method are definedin Terminology E631.3.2 Definitions of Terms Specific to This Standar
10、d:3.2.1 automatically controlled heater, na heater where theburn rate is controlled by a means other than the direct actionof adjustment of a burn rate control device by the heater user.This includes heaters with thermostats, proportional controllersor other electronic or mechanical devices that con
11、trol the heateroperation in response to a room or other temperature set point.3.2.2 burn pot, nthe vessel or other defined area within thefirebox where fuel and air meet to initiate combustion.3.2.3 burn rate, nthe rate at which test fuel is consumed inthe pellet heater during a test run. Measured i
12、n kilograms (lb)(dry basis) per hour.3.2.4 firebox, nthe chamber in the pellet heater in whichprimary combustion of the fuel occurs.3.2.5 fuel feed system, nmechanism for delivering fuelfrom the hopper to the burn pot.1This test method is under the jurisdiction of ASTM Committee E06 onPerformance of

17、Trade Organization Technical Barriers to Trade (TBT) Committee.13.2.6 fuel grade, nvariations in the properties of fuelwithin any given fuel type. For wood pellets, grading is inaccordance with PFI Standard Specification for Residential/Commercial Densified Fuel is an example. For other fuel types,c
18、ertain physical or chemical properties may be used to differ-entiate between higher and lower fuel grades.3.2.7 fuel hopper, ncontainer where fuel is held beforebeing delivered to the burn pot by the fuel feed system.3.2.8 fuel type, nfor a pelletized fuel, the fuel type isdefined by the material th
19、at was pelletized (for example, “woodpellets” or “switch grass pellets”), and for non-pelletized fuel,the fuel type is defined by the material itself (for example,“corn,” “walnut hulls” or “cherry pits”).3.2.9 manually controlled heater, na heater where theburn rate is controlled by the direct actio
20、n of adjustment of aburn rate control device by the heater user.3.2.10 manufacturers written instructions, nspecific in-formation regarding the fueling and operation proceduresrecommended by the heater manufacturer and included withthe heater. These instructions must be consistent with informa-tion
21、provided to the heater end-user in the owners manual orequivalent.3.2.11 owners manual, nwritten information provided tothe heater end-user regarding the installation and recom-mended fueling and operating procedures that will help theheater user to achieve the best heater performance. It is alsoref
22、erred as the installation and operation guide or otherequivalent title.3.2.12 particulate matter (PM), nall gas-borne matterresulting from combustion of solid fuel, as specified in this testmethod, which is collected in accordance with Test MethodE2515.3.2.13 pellet burning heater, na heater specifi
23、cally de-signed to burn pellet, granular or particulate fuels only, andwhich includes a fuel hopper and fuel feed system as integralparts.3.2.14 pellet heater venting, nventing system or compo-nents specified for use with the pellet heater by the pellet heatermanufacturer.3.2.15 test facility, nthe
24、area in which the pellet heater isinstalled, operated, and sampled for emissions.3.2.16 test fuel, nfor any fuel type recommended by themanufacturer in the manufacturers written instructions or theowners manual for use in the pellet heater, the test fuel whenmore than one fuel grade is recommended i
